Metadata-Version: 2.4
Name: hex_sl
Version: 0.0.87
Summary: A simple semantic layer
Author-email: Jon Mease <jonmmease@gmail.com>
Requires-Python: >=3.10
Requires-Dist: pydantic>=2.7
Requires-Dist: lark
Requires-Dist: ruamel.yaml
Requires-Dist: duckdb>=1.0
Requires-Dist: polars>=1.5
Requires-Dist: networkx>=2.6.3
Requires-Dist: sqlglot>=25.6
Requires-Dist: lkml>=1.3.1
Requires-Dist: ibis-framework>=9.3
Requires-Dist: dbt-common>=1.14.0
Requires-Dist: Jinja2<4,>=3.1.3
Provides-Extra: mypy
Requires-Dist: mypy==1.10.0; extra == "mypy"
Requires-Dist: types-networkx>=3.1; extra == "mypy"
Requires-Dist: networkx>=3.1; extra == "mypy"
Provides-Extra: mcp
Requires-Dist: mcp[cli]>=1.3.0rc1; extra == "mcp"
Requires-Dist: anyio>=4.6.0; extra == "mcp"
Requires-Dist: httpx>=0.24.0; extra == "mcp"
Requires-Dist: asyncio>=3.4.3; extra == "mcp"
Provides-Extra: drivers
Requires-Dist: clickhouse-connect>=0.7; extra == "drivers"
Requires-Dist: pandas<2.2,>=2.1; extra == "drivers"
Requires-Dist: SQLAlchemy<2,>=1.4; extra == "drivers"
Requires-Dist: PyMySQL; extra == "drivers"
Requires-Dist: pyspark[sql]; extra == "drivers"
Requires-Dist: trino; extra == "drivers"
Requires-Dist: snowflake-connector-python; extra == "drivers"
Requires-Dist: google-cloud-bigquery<4,>=3.0.0; extra == "drivers"
Requires-Dist: google-cloud-bigquery-storage<3,>=2.0.0; extra == "drivers"
Requires-Dist: redshift_connector>=2.1.3; extra == "drivers"
Requires-Dist: sqlalchemy-redshift>=0.8.14; extra == "drivers"
Requires-Dist: python-dotenv; extra == "drivers"
Requires-Dist: pyarrow; extra == "drivers"
Requires-Dist: pyarrow_hotfix; extra == "drivers"
Requires-Dist: ruff-api==0.1.0; extra == "drivers"
Provides-Extra: dev
Requires-Dist: pytest; extra == "dev"
Requires-Dist: pytest-benchmark==4; extra == "dev"
Requires-Dist: ruff==0.9.3; extra == "dev"
Requires-Dist: ruff-lsp==0.0.60; extra == "dev"
Requires-Dist: build; extra == "dev"
Requires-Dist: pre-commit; extra == "dev"
Requires-Dist: inline-snapshot>=0.10; extra == "dev"
Requires-Dist: setuptools_scm>=8; extra == "dev"
Requires-Dist: requests; extra == "dev"
Requires-Dist: gitpython<4,>=3.1.43; extra == "dev"
Requires-Dist: jupyterlab; extra == "dev"
Requires-Dist: dbt-metricflow==0.8.1; extra == "dev"
Requires-Dist: metricflow==0.207.2; extra == "dev"
Requires-Dist: dbt-duckdb==1.9.0; extra == "dev"
Requires-Dist: protobuf>=5.28.3; extra == "dev"
Provides-Extra: doc
Requires-Dist: sphinx; extra == "doc"
Requires-Dist: sphinx-autodoc-typehints; extra == "doc"
Requires-Dist: myst-parser; extra == "doc"
Requires-Dist: furo; extra == "doc"
Requires-Dist: sphinxcontrib-repl; extra == "doc"
Requires-Dist: autodoc-pydantic; extra == "doc"
Requires-Dist: sphinxcontrib-mermaid; extra == "doc"
Requires-Dist: sphinx-toolbox; extra == "doc"
